As parents, we know how important it is for children to have safe, open spaces to play, explore, and grow.

That’s why we fully support Sunset Dunes—San Francisco’s newest oceanfront park built on the former Great Highway.

This park is a gift to families across the city. It gives kids room to ride bikes, climb, run, and enjoy nature by the beach.

 In just its first month, it saw 150,000 visitors. It’s already the third-most popular park in the city.

But now, Sunset Dunes is under threat.

A group of opponents is trying to undo the park—filing lawsuits, pushing recalls, and attacking city leaders who made it possible. Some want to bring cars back to the road, even as families are finally enjoying a space designed for people, not traffic.

This park is not just about leisure—it’s about public health, climate, community, and childhood. We need more safe places like Sunset Dunes, not fewer.
